Local Area Positioned in the scenic countryside of Hampshire and just a 12-minute drive to Basingstoke, Tadley is a bustling village with rural qualities and plenty to do. Developed in the 1950s and 60s to accommodate an influx of new residents, Tadley has a peaceful, laid-back feel and a strong sense of community. Just east of Tadley and a 10-minute drive away, visitors will find the remarkably well-preserved remains of Calleva Atrebatum, a once-important Roman town. Thanks to its excellent location and the fact that it has never been built over, it has been subject to decades of archaeological investigations, revealing a surprisingly in-depth portrayal of Roman Life. Continuing the historic sights that surround Tadley, a Tudor mansion, The Vyne is also close by. This National Trust property is a glorious example of Tudor architecture, tapestries and gardening, and it has plenty of seasonal activities and things for every age to do. Closer to home, Bishopswood Golf Course is just a 2-minute drive from this development and is a striking 9-hole course carved through the natural woodland and peaceful water hazards of the area. There are plenty of countryside walks nearby too, with a variety of cosy local pubs to recharge in, dine in and enjoy a relaxed drink (or two) in. This development is tucked away in a residential hub, with a surgery next door and Tadley Pool just down the street. Koala, the local convenience shop will provide residents with essentials, while a 15-minute walk or 2-minute drive down to the road will take them to a large Sainsbury?s.
